I don\'t know anything about the poodle version. What you are more than likely wanting to flash is the 3.2 version. Once flased, add the poodle version as a feed and update packages. As it has \"experimental in the URL path, It is quite safe to say stuff might break. I personally have never seen ANY ROM leave your Z an expensive piece of plastic. If it does leave your Z unbootable, you can download the Sharpie ROM in a single file from ZUG Downloads. Put that file at the root of your CF, follow the same instructions for flashing OZ and you can go about your merry way.
